The affordability dashboard for Battiest, OK aggregates Census ACS 5-Year Estimates across 1 ZIP code covering 286 residents, then layers in county-level federal data to produce an overall grade of D (47/100). The headline inputs are median household income of $57,083, median home value of , median rent of $569 per month, and 11.8% of adults holding a bachelor's degree or higher. These four metrics alone explain most of the variance between city dashboards.

Cross-agency feeds widen the picture beyond Census demographics. HUD publishes a Fair Market Rent for a 2-bedroom in this county at $937 per month (studio $646, 1BR $747, 3BR $1,256, 4BR $1,448). Department of Labor data lists infant center-based childcare at $10,106 per year, consuming 18% of the local median household income.

Reading the overall grade requires reading all seven dimensions together. The score weights Income 20%, Safety 20%, Housing 15%, Rent 15%, Education 10%, Commute 10%, and Childcare 10%, with each sub-score benchmarked against national percentiles rather than state averages — so the grade is genuinely comparable across any city in the country. Strengths visible in the raw data for Battiest, OK include rent. Pressure points are education. Unemployment currently reads 8.3% and poverty 18.4% — numbers worth keeping alongside the headline grade.
